Transaction 5cf101d90434c64b9dcf36fbe36065ee81a59004f56ef91d0b5184d3a6a966c8
1 Input
1 Output
-
5cf101d90434c64b9dcf36fbe36065ee81a59004f56ef91d0b5184d3a6a966c8:0
- value
- 7222456
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 879ee7eed4e156bcddcc6422cc428072082fc23a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DN6asy17ovD8g7U7PPNmY7HVp4RP1tKK8